Asbestos removing is an important process in UK structures. For construction purposes asbestos was previously very well liked in the United Kingdom largely for the insulating qualities. But with linked health risks the Government enforced a ban on its use in 2006.

In spite of this you will still find numerous homes with asbestos used in the ceilings and walls. And the effects of extented exposure can be very damaging to your health, with two forms of lung cancer related with asbestos.

Average Asbestos removal cost in Port Glasgow

Asbestos removal costs fluctuate according to the amount of material you have that needs removing, how easy it is to access and remove, and your location. However, the average price for an asbestos removal project in the UK is about £800.

Port Glasgow

Port Glasgow is a large town in Scotland's Renfrewshire. As the second largest community in the Inverclyde council area, it has a population of around 15,414, according to the 2011 Demographics, which has in fact declined from 19,426 in the 1991 Demographics. Commonly called Newark, its name changed to Port Glasgow in 1775 as a result of ships being not able to take a trip right up the shallow river Clyde making the town largely a port for Glasgow from 1668. The town created from the primary location of the present community, which suggests that several of the town's historic structures and spots can be located in the town centre. Port Glasgow gradually incorporated the steep hillsides inland to open up areas where such popular locations as Park Ranch, Boglstone, Slaemuir as well as Devol were developed. The majority of the community's population lives in these locations. Port Glasgow has a plethora of destinations for both its citizens as well as visitors. Newark Castle, situated really close to the shore of the Clyde, goes back to around 1484. Between its establishment and also 1694, it was inhabited by the Maxwell Family members. It is presently open up to members of the public as a site visitor destination, protected by Historical Scotland. Neighbouring the castle are many acres of the Clyde foreshore at Parklea, possessed by the National Trust for Scotland. Port Glasgow F.C., have actually recently returned to being based in the community, playing in a brand-new stadium at Parklea. A regrowth programme has actually also removed the means for several local as well as nationwide stores to develop themselves in the community, as obvious in the retail park which contains a huge grocery store, a public residence, a coffeehouse and also a dining establishment.     what does asbestos cause?

    What Does Asbestos Cause?

    The perfect example of a silent killer is asbestos. Wonder why? From the day of exposure, you might not see any symptoms of the asbestos containing material disease till years later and more often than not, these disease are not treatable. And as dangerous at it is, it’s most likely not something you’d think about on a daily basis unless you’ve been affected by this harmful material or probably someone you know has.

    Found in rocks and soils, asbestos have been an important material for manufacturers across the globe for numerous reasons. Not only are they exceptional insulation materials in both electrical and buildings, but they’re also flexible and resistant to heat, chemicals as well as electricity. And due to this fact, they represent a very common material that’s used in automotive parts, construction materials as well as textiles.

    Asbestos when disturbed and inhaled for a long period of time can significantly increase your risk for diseases such as lung cancer, mesothelioma as well as asbestosis. Smokers are more likely feel a greater impact as cigarette smoke irritates lung passages which makes it a lot more difficult for the lungs to remove asbestos fibres.

    Mesothelioma. This is a form of cancer that affects the lining of the lungs as well as the lining surrounding the lower digestive tract. By the time diagnosed, it’s almost always fatal.

    Lung Cancer. This asbestos related lung cancer is almost the same with that caused by smoking and other causes.

    Abestosis. This is a serious scarring condition of the lung which usually occurs after exposure to asbestos after a lengthy period. It can lead to shortness of breath, and in some cases, can be fatal.

    Should asbestos be removed?

    If you find out there’s asbestos in your property, it’s not always necessary to remove it. Asbestos is relatively low-risk if it’s contained in a material. This means that, if the material it’s in is in good condition, it shouldn’t be a problem.

    However, if a material containing asbestos is damaged, or you want to remove, sand or drill into it, it’s best to have it removed by a licensed professional.
